Output e28acb36e230e5baa045af37d32cc55efc85354b9975014d760c4b824648703d:0

value
18889445
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15213f5840db47f1a522514dee5f4da66f2c6e48 OP_EQUAL
address
M9ptFXmVR7dd8h9bbdBaBDriUMbqKnpxUn
transaction
e28acb36e230e5baa045af37d32cc55efc85354b9975014d760c4b824648703d
spent
true